By joining you are opting in to receive e-mail. ALZDBA special names ? You cannot post events. The error that Iam getting when i run the bat file containing bcp is “bcp is not recognised as an internal or external command” is this because there is no SQL his comment is here
You can use the bcp utility to export data from a table or view or through a query. It needs to be in one long query statement. For example, the following bcp command specifies the login ID acct1 when accessing the SQL Server instance: 1 bcp AdventureWorks2008.HumanResources.Employee out C:\Data\EmployeeData.dat -S localhost\SqlSrv2008 -Uacct1 When you run this command, you This is because the character format (-c) is used to create the format file.
measurable linear functionals are also continuous on separable Banach spaces? Columns in Data File in Different Order than Table In some cases, the columns in a table will be in a different order from the fields in a data file. If you’re still having issues please post a specific example.
I’ve tried… bcp "SELECT * FROM table_name" queryout \10.253.1.5c$shareexport_data.dat" -c -t, -S 10.253.1.5 -T and it didnt work. If not report back on the error. –Martin Smith Mar 18 '11 at 23:16 I ran in cmd prompt and still gave me error. –user387268 Mar 18 '11 at Join Now For immediate help use Live now! Already a member?
You should expect tiny transaction 1k-row per time but it is not! Googling about this, I found one comment that says “You cannot have SARG in bcp. There are quite a few possibilities (bcp not in your PATH, wrong server name, wrong login credentials) and it is impossible for me to guess! –Martin Smith Mar 18 '11 at In a command prompt? –Martin Smith Mar 18 '11 at 23:09 add a comment| 5 Answers 5 active oldest votes up vote 4 down vote I get the same error if
Unfortunately I got the same result, no output, no txt file. Find out how to automate the process of building, testing and deploying your database changes to reduce risk and make rapid releases possible. First Name Please enter a first name Last Name Please enter a last name Email We will never share this with anyone. When the character format (-c) is used in a bcp command, each field, by default, is terminated with a tab character, and each row is terminated with a newline character.
When you run any of the commands shown in the preceding examples, you will be prompted for information about each column in the source table or view. If you import into a view, all columns within the view must reference a single table. (Note that, when you specify a table or view, you must qualify the name with This is a great…. For example, you can use the -o argument to specify an output file.
So I would advise to always set up a block size (-b) so that you are aware of the real block that is inserted within the same transaction. http://mmonoplayer.com/syntax-error/syntax-error-example-in-vb-net.html Thanks in anticipation Paul Hunter BCP Support Kartik, Remember the form of the command: bcp “destination/source table/view/procedure/SQL” direction “source/destination file” arguments The way I normally handle it is to have it In addition, the data will be saved to the data file with the character format and a comma as the field terminator. After you've created the format file, you can run a bcp command similar to the following to import the data into the Contact4 table: 1 bcp AdventureWorks2008..Contacts4 in C:\Data\PersonData_c.dat -f C:\Data\PersonFormat_c4.xml
You cannot edit other posts. You still specify the data file, the format, and any other applicable options. When your bcp command retrieves data from a table or view, it copies all the data. weblink Please check $FC_LOG_FILE for details.\n" exit 1 fi #Call fc_AddHeaderFooter.sh $FC_HOME/script/fc_AddHeaderFooter.sh $SIFNAME $SIFVERSION $CLIENT $SIFFILEDIR $FC_LOG_FILE # $Comments is optional ret=$?
However, when you use the queryout option rather than the out option, you can be as specific in your query as necessary-you can include multiple tables and you can qualify your Pls help halifaxdal How to work on rpt or csv file Thank you so much Robert for writing such a great article on bcp, I am currently working on importing data The T-SQL interpreter knows nothing of it.
Thank you, Iker ‹ Previous Thread|Next Thread › This site is managed for Microsoft by Neudesic, LLC. | © 2016 Microsoft. ranjandba New Member when i execute below query i got the error message like "syntax error on "queryout"..." query:bcp "select * from msdb..sysjobs" queryout d:sysjobs.txt -S servername -T -c can u You can modify either the non-XML or XML format files to accommodate these differences. asking the question the right way gets you a tested answer the fastest way possible!
Indeed, once you've learned to work with the bcp utility, you should be able to handle most of your bulk copy needs. Returning to the format file above, notice that it lists SQLCHAR as the data type for all fields in the data file. I’ve never had this fail. check over here You cannot edit other events.
Register now while it's still free! You cannot edit your own events. In addition, you can import data into a table or view. Reply limno All-Star 121504 Points 9421 Posts Moderator Re: bcp queryout syntax Jul 21, 2009 09:33 PM|limno|LINK declare @sql varchar(8000) declare @p1 int declare @p2 int declare @p3 intSET @p1=1
Joshua shows how to build a virtual lab, from the ground up in the first of a series that aims to give you a grounding in Azure.… Read more Paul Hunter BCP vs referential integrity: I have been exposed to an issue concrning a table with constraint (FK, CK, PK). Now let's look at how to import data. The error that Iam getting when i run the bat file containing bcp is “bcp is not recognised as an internal or external command” is this because there is no SQL
Niall Is bcp quicker than SSIS? Solved Copy direction must be either 'in' or 'out'. Now let's look at an example that demonstrates how the format options work. Can a free radical be created by chemical reaction of non-radical species?
Network packet size (bytes): 4096 Clock Time (ms.) Total : 1 Please help me with a suggestion ecauwels This was extremely helpful I was using bcp for the first time and An output file captures the information normally returned to the command prompt after your run a bcp command. Need a way for Earth not to detect an extrasolar civilization that has radio What is this strange biplane jet aircraft with tanks between wings? You cannot send private messages.
However, you can just as easily copy data from a view, as in the following example: 1 bcp AdventureWorks2008.HumanResources.vEmployee out C:\Data\EmployeeData_c.dat -c -t, -S localhost\SqlSrv2008 -T This command is identical to Importing Data into a Table When you use the bcp utility to import data into a SQL Server table, you must specify the in mode, rather than out or queryout. And I can do the same thing for the native format XML file: 1 bcp AdventureWorks2008..Contacts1 in C:\Data\PersonData_n.dat -f C:\Data\PersonFormat_n.xml -S localhost\sqlsrv2008 -T In the examples we've looked at so far, The script can be found at: http://www.sqlservercentral.com/scripts/SQL+Server+2005+%2f+SQL+Server+2008/67764/ I’d appreciate any feedback on the procedure.
For example, the FirstName column is now set to 3 because it is the third column in the table, and the LastName column is set to 2 because it is the To specify the batch size, include the -b argument, along with the number of rows per batch. BCP Syntax error??? You cannot upload attachments.